What Is √724 and Why It Matters

The square root of 724 is 26.907 because 26.907 × 26.907 ≈ 724. 724 is not a perfect square, so its square root is an irrational number that continues forever without repeating. The simplified radical form is 2√181.

Prime Factorization

Prime factors: 724 = 2 × 2 × 181. Simplify: √724 = 2√181.

Answer: √724 = 2√181 ≈ 26.907
